Under the Voluntary Leave Transfer Program (VLTP), a covered employee may donate annual leave directly to another employee who has a personal or family medical emergency and who has exhausted his or her available paid leave. Each agency must administer a voluntary leave transfer program for its employees.
The employee donating the leave may not claim an expense, charitable contribution, or loss deduction for any leave donated. The IRS has provided guidance on what constitutes a bona fide employer-sponsored leave-sharing arrangement under the medical emergency exception.
If you want to donate annual leave to somebody who has been approved as a recipient, you must complete form OPM-630A. You submit the completed form to your servicing human resources office.
Employer-sponsored leave-sharing programs provide employees with the opportunity to donate their accrued PTO, vacation or sick leave for the benefit of other employees who are in need of additional paid leave time. Typically, an employer establishes a leave-sharing “bank” to track the donated employee leave.

The Voluntary Leave Transfer Program (VLTP) is a program that permits Federal civilian employees to donate annual leave to other Federal civilian employees who are experiencing personal medical or family medical emergencies.

The Donated Leave Employee Request Form is a document used by employees to formally request the donation of leave hours from colleagues in order to supplement their own leave balance during a period of personal or medical need.
Employees who have exhausted their available leave and require additional time off due to personal health issues, family emergencies, or similar circumstances are required to file the Donated Leave Employee Request Form.
To fill out the Donated Leave Employee Request Form, employees must provide personal information, details about their leave situation, the amount of leave being requested, and any relevant medical documentation, if necessary.
The purpose of the Donated Leave Employee Request Form is to facilitate the process of obtaining additional leave from colleagues, ensuring that employees in need can receive support while managing personal hardships without losing their job security.
The information that must be reported on the Donated Leave Employee Request Form includes the employee's name, position, department, the reason for leave, the amount of leave requested, and any related dates, alongside any supporting documentation required.
